Bulldog vs Norrbottenspets

You’re not going to see a Bulldog and a Norrbottenspets side by side at the dog park every day, but people compare them when they’re looking for a loyal, medium-to-small dog with personality and hit a wall on size alone. That’s where the similarities end. One was built for medieval blood sports in English towns, the other for tracking grouse in Arctic snow. They couldn’t be more different under the skin. The Bulldog is your couch philosopher. He’s calm, affectionate, and happy to spend the day parked beside you. He doesn’t need a lot of space, so apartment life works. if your building stays cool. His flat face means heat and humidity can knock him out fast, and vet bills? Brace yourself. You’re signing up for potential breathing issues, skin fold cleanings, and a shorter time together. 8 to 10 years, maybe less if health problems pile up. But he’s sweet, stubborn in that endearing way, and bonds deeply with his family. Now picture the Norrbottenspets: a spry, fox-faced Nordic hunter with a motor that runs on cold air and curiosity. This dog wakes up ready to work. He’s not loud, but he’s alert, always scanning, ears pricked at distant sounds. He bonds closely, yes, but he’s not lounging all day. He’ll herd your kids, chase squirrels with precision, and need real mental challenges. If you’re not outdoorsy, you’ll lose him to boredom. Here’s the truth the breeders won’t emphasize: the Bulldog’s calmness often comes at the cost of chronic health management, while the Norrbottenspets’ vitality demands engagement, not fixes. Pick the Bulldog if you want a quiet, loving companion and can handle medical vigilance. Pick the Norrbottenspets if you want a partner, not a pet, and live where winter doesn’t scare you.
